หน้าแรก
หน้าแรก
โดยการเพิ่มสตริงใน python เราเพียงแค่เชื่อมเข้าด้วยกันเพื่อรับสตริงใหม่ สิ่งนี้มีประโยชน์ในหลาย ๆ สถานการณ์ เช่น การวิเคราะห์ข้อความ ฯลฯ ด้านล่างนี้คือสองแนวทางที่เราพิจารณาสำหรับงานนี้ การใช้ +=โอเปอเรเตอร์ ตัวดำเนินการ + สามารถใช้สำหรับสตริงที่เหมือนกันได้เช่นเดียวกับตัวเลข ความแตกต่างเพียงอย่างเ
ในการวิเคราะห์ข้อมูล บางครั้งจำเป็นต้องเพิ่มคุณค่าให้กับแต่ละองค์ประกอบในรายการ python เพื่อตัดสินผลลัพธ์ของสถานการณ์ใหม่ ซึ่งช่วยในการทดสอบสถานการณ์ต่างๆ ว่าชุดข้อมูลจะทำงานอย่างไรกับค่าต่างๆ กัน ดังนั้นจึงสร้างแบบจำลองหรืออัลกอริธึมที่สามารถจัดการกับสถานการณ์เหล่านั้นได้ ในบทความนี้ เราจะมาดูกันว่
ข้อความ ASCII สามารถใช้เพื่อแสดงข้อความที่มีสไตล์ได้โดยใช้โมดูล pyfiglet หลังจากติดตั้งโมดูลนี้แล้ว เราสามารถใช้โมดูลนี้เพื่อควบคุมแบบอักษรที่สามารถใช้แสดงผลได้ ในโปรแกรมด้านล่าง เราจะเห็นผลลัพธ์ที่หลากหลายโดยการเลือกแบบอักษรต่างๆ ตัวอย่าง # import pyfiglet module import pyfiglet #Text in default fo
หลายครั้งที่เราใช้วิธีการที่เรียกว่าการปรับข้อมูลให้เรียบเพื่อให้ข้อมูลเหมาะสมและมีคุณภาพสำหรับการวิเคราะห์ทางสถิติ ในระหว่างกระบวนการสูบบุหรี่ เรากำหนดช่วงที่เรียกว่า bin และค่าข้อมูลใดๆ ภายในช่วงนั้นถูกสร้างขึ้นเพื่อให้พอดีกับถังขยะ นี้เรียกว่าวิธีการ binning ด้านล่างนี้เป็นตัวอย่างของ binning จาก
Tkinter เป็นไลบรารีสร้าง GUI ของ python ในบทความนี้ เราจะมาดูกันว่าเราจะสร้างบานหน้าต่างที่ยุบได้ได้อย่างไร สิ่งเหล่านี้มีประโยชน์เมื่อเรามีข้อมูลจำนวนมากที่จะแสดงบนผืนผ้าใบ GUI แต่เราไม่ต้องการให้แสดงเสมอ มันถูกทำให้พับได้เพื่อให้สามารถแสดงได้ตามต้องการและเมื่อจำเป็น โปรแกรมด้านล่างสร้างบานหน้าต่า
พจนานุกรม Python มีคู่คีย์และค่า ในบางสถานการณ์ เราจำเป็นต้องจัดเรียงรายการในพจนานุกรมตามคีย์ ในบทความนี้ เราจะเห็นวิธีต่างๆ ในการรับผลลัพธ์ที่เรียงลำดับจากรายการในพจนานุกรม การใช้โมดูลตัวดำเนินการ โมดูล Operator มีฟังก์ชัน itemgetter ซึ่งสามารถรับ 0 เป็นดัชนีของพารามิเตอร์อินพุตสำหรับคีย์ของพจนานุ
แทนที่จะฮาร์ดโค้ดพาธไปยังไฟล์ที่จะใช้โดยโปรแกรม python เราสามารถอนุญาตให้ผู้ใช้เรียกดูโครงสร้างโฟลเดอร์ os โดยใช้ GUI และให้ผู้ใช้เลือกไฟล์ได้ ซึ่งทำได้โดยใช้โมดูล tkinter ซึ่งเรากำหนดผืนผ้าใบและใส่ปุ่มเพื่อเรียกดูไฟล์ ในโปรแกรมด้านล่าง เรากำหนดฟังก์ชันเปิดไฟล์ เราใช้ฟังก์ชันนี้เพื่อเปิดไฟล์ข้อความ
หากเราพิมพ์รายการสตริงตามที่เป็นอยู่ เราต้องใช้เครื่องหมายคำพูดและกรอกเครื่องหมายคำพูดที่ตรงกันอย่างเหมาะสม เราสามารถหลีกเลี่ยงการใช้เครื่องหมายคำพูดในคำสั่งการพิมพ์โดยทำตามสองวิธี ใช้ join() วิธีการเข้าร่วมช่วยเราในการพิมพ์ผลลัพธ์ขององค์ประกอบรายการโดยใช้ตัวคั่นที่เราเลือก ในตัวอย่างด้านล่าง เราเล
bigram เกิดขึ้นจากการสร้างคำสองคำจากทุก ๆ สองคำที่ต่อเนื่องกันจากประโยคที่กำหนด ใน python เทคนิคนี้ใช้อย่างมากในการวิเคราะห์ข้อความ ด้านล่างนี้ เราเห็นแนวทางสองวิธีในการบรรลุเป้าหมายนี้ การใช้การแจงนับและการแยก ขั้นแรกเราใช้สองวิธีนี้แบ่งประโยคออกเป็นคำหลายๆ คำ แล้วใช้ฟังก์ชัน enumerate เพื่อสร้างค
Python มีความสามารถในการจัดรูปแบบเนื้อหาของวิธีการพิมพ์โดยใช้วิธีการพิเศษที่เรียกว่า Pretty print หรือ pprint ตัวอย่างเช่น เมื่อเราอ่านเนื้อหาของ url ที่อยู่ในรูปแบบ json เนื้อหาจะถูกพิมพ์เป็นบรรทัดเดียวซึ่งอ่านหรือเข้าใจยาก แต่ถ้าเราใช้การพิมพ์ที่สวยงาม python จะให้โครงสร้างน้ำแข็งตามแท็ก json ไม่ม
การพิมพ์เครื่องหมายคำพูดคู่นั้นทำได้ยาก เนื่องจากจำเป็นต้องใช้เป็นส่วนหนึ่งของไวยากรณ์เพื่อพิมพ์สตริงโดยล้อมรอบ ในบทความนี้เราจะมาดูกันว่าสามารถพิมพ์เครื่องหมายคำพูดคู่เหล่านี้ได้อย่างไรโดยใช้คำสั่งพิมพ์ สถานการณ์ด้านล่างจะไม่พิมพ์อัญประกาศคู่ โค้ดสองบรรทัดแรกจะไม่แสดงผลในขณะที่โค้ดสุดท้ายจะเกิดข้อ
ระหว่างการจัดการข้อมูลโดยใช้ python เราอาจจำเป็นต้องตรวจสอบชนิดข้อมูลของตัวแปรที่กำลังถูกจัดการ สิ่งนี้จะช่วยเราในการใช้วิธีการหรือฟังก์ชันที่เหมาะสมกับประเภทข้อมูลนั้นๆ ในบทความนี้ เราจะมาดูกันว่าเราจะทราบได้อย่างไรว่าตัวแปรนั้นเป็นประเภทข้อมูลสตริงหรือไม่ การใช้ type() type() วิธีการประเมินชนิดข้
Python มีความยืดหยุ่นมากในการจัดการโครงสร้างข้อมูลประเภทต่างๆ อาจมีความจำเป็นเมื่อคุณต้องแปลงโครงสร้างข้อมูลหนึ่งเป็นโครงสร้างอื่นเพื่อการใช้งานที่ดีขึ้นหรือการวิเคราะห์ข้อมูลที่ดีขึ้น ในบทความนี้เราจะมาดูวิธีการแปลงชุด Python เป็นพจนานุกรม Python การใช้ zip และ dict dict() สามารถใช้เพื่อรับพารามิเ
ในการวิเคราะห์ข้อมูลหรือประมวลผลข้อมูลโดยใช้ python เราพบสถานการณ์ที่ต้องสร้างรายการที่กำหนดใหม่หรือจัดรูปแบบใหม่เพื่อให้ได้รายการที่มีคอลัมน์ต่างกัน เราสามารถทำได้หลายวิธีดังที่กล่าวไว้ด้านล่าง การใช้สไลซ์ เราสามารถแบ่งรายการที่องค์ประกอบบางอย่างเพื่อสร้างโครงสร้างคอลัมน์ ที่นี่เราแปลงรายการที่กำห
ในบทความนี้ เราจะมาดูวิธีการสร้างรายการที่มีประเภทข้อมูลสตริง รายการภายในหรือของประเภทข้อมูลสตริงและอาจมีตัวเลขหรือสตริงเป็นองค์ประกอบ การใช้แถบและการแยก เราใช้สองวิธีนี้ซึ่งจะแยกรายการออกก่อน จากนั้นจึงแปลงแต่ละองค์ประกอบของรายการเป็นสตริง ตัวอย่าง list1 = [ '[0, 1, 2, 3]','["Mon&
สมมติว่าเรามีอาร์เรย์ A ของจำนวนเต็มเฉพาะที่เรียงลำดับจากน้อยไปหามาก เราต้องคืนค่าดัชนีที่เล็กที่สุด i ที่ตรงกับ A[i] ==i ส่งคืน -1 หากไม่มีฉันอยู่ ดังนั้นหากอาร์เรย์เป็นเหมือน [-10,-5,0,3,7] ผลลัพธ์จะเป็น 3 เนื่องจาก A[3] =3 เอาต์พุตจะเป็น 3 เพื่อแก้ปัญหานี้ เราจะทำตามขั้นตอนเหล่านี้ - สำหรับฉันใ
สมมติว่าเรามีสตริงข้อความและคำ (รายการสตริง) เราต้องหาคู่ดัชนีทั้งหมด [i, j] เพื่อให้สตริงย่อย text[i]...text [j] อยู่ในรายการคำ ดังนั้นหากสตริงเป็นเหมือน ababa และอาร์เรย์คำเป็นเหมือน [aba, ab] ผลลัพธ์จะเป็น [[0,1], [0,2], [2,3], [2 ,4]]. สิ่งหนึ่งที่เราสังเกตได้คือไม้ขีดสามารถทับซ้อนกันได้ aba จะถ
สมมติว่าเรามีอาร์เรย์ A ของจำนวนเต็มและกำหนดจำนวนเต็ม K อื่น เราต้องหาค่าสูงสุดของ S เพื่อให้มี i
สมมติว่าเรามี 1 ปี Y และ 1 เดือน M เราต้องคืนค่าจำนวนวันของเดือนนั้นสำหรับปีที่กำหนด ดังนั้นหาก Y =1992 และ M =7 ผลลัพธ์จะเป็น 31 หากปีคือ 2020 และ M =2 ผลลัพธ์จะเป็น 29 เพื่อแก้ปัญหานี้ เราจะทำตามขั้นตอนเหล่านี้ - ถ้า m =2 แล้ว ถ้า y เป็นปีอธิกสุรทิน ให้คืน 29 มิฉะนั้น 28 สร้างอาร์เรย์ที่มีองค์
สมมติว่าเรามีสตริง เราต้องลบสระทั้งหมดออกจากสตริงนั้น ดังนั้นหากสตริงนั้นเหมือนกับ “iloveprogramming” หลังจากลบสระออก ผลลัพธ์จะเป็น − lvprgrmmng เพื่อแก้ปัญหานี้ เราจะทำตามขั้นตอนเหล่านี้ - สร้างสระอาเรย์หนึ่งตัวที่ถือ [a,e,i,o,u] สำหรับ v ในสระ แทนที่ v โดยใช้สตริงว่าง ตัวอย่าง ให้เราดูการใช้ง